Are these sentences true or false?

Correct the false ones

1. A policeman has to wear a uniform.

2. Firefighters don´t have to be brave.

3. A cashier doesn´t have to be polite.

4. Teachers have to be patient.

5. A businesswoman has to be funny.

6. A waiter has to be rude.

7. Soldiers don´t have to be strong.

8. A secretary has to type very well.

9. Shop assistans have to wear a helmet.

10. Builders don´t have to speak Chinese.

Correct the grammar mistakes

1. Soldiers has to wear a uniform.

2. A cashier don´t have to be brave.

3. A waiter have does to be polite.

4. Teachers have to be patient.

5. A businesswoman not have to be funny.

6. A secretary have to be hardworking.
